  2. Gugu63
     
    Hello everyone,
    To install Solidworks 2008 sp0 on win7, you simply need to go to the directory Solidworks\swwi\data\French_i386_SolidWorks.msi. Right-click and troubleshoot compatibility.

    There you go, it's done...
